Modelo Compartido y Trabajo en Equipo

Superior  Previo  Próximo

Introduciendo el desarrollo de equipo

 

EA ofrece un conjunto de diversas funcionalidades designadas específicamente para compartir proyectos en entornos de desarrollo basado en el equipo y distribuidos. La función de compartir un proyecto se puede alcanzar a través de varios mecanismos incluyendo el despliegue de la red de trabajo de los repositorios del modelo, replicación, Importar/exportar XMI, Control de Versiones, Control de Paquete y Seguridad del Usuario. 

 

El despliegue de la red se puede emprender usando dos esquemas diferentes para despliegue, usando: 

repositorios basados en .EAP o
repositorios basados en DBMS server.

Replicación requiere el uso de repositorios basados en .EAP , y no se pueden realizar en repositorios almacenados en un servidor DBMS. Repositorios basados en un servidor DBMS ofrecen mejores tiempos de respuestas que los archivos de .EAP en redes debido a la estructura inherente de los DBMS. Los DBMS también ofrecen una mejor solución cuando se encuentran problemas de red, ya que ellos tienen la capacidad de rastrear transacciones causadas por descomposiciones externas.

 

Replicación

Replicación es un proceso simple que permite intercambio de datos entre los repositorios basados en .EAP (no DBMS) y es apropiado para usarlo en situaciones donde varios usuarios diferentes trabajan independientemente. Los  modeladores combinan sus cambios en un Diseño Maestro en un "como base requerida". Con la replicación es recomendable que se realice una copia anterior a la replicación. 

 

Exportar importar XMI

La importación/Exportación XMI se puede usar para modelar paquetes discretos que pueden ser exportados y compartidos entre los desarrolladores. XMI permite la exportación de paquetes en archivos XML que pueden ser luego importados en cualquier modelo.

 

El control de paquete se puede usar para configurar paquetes para control de versiones y permitir la exportación por lote de paquetes usando XMI. El Control de Versiones permite que un repositorio se mantenga por una aplicación de control de código fuente de terceras partes la que se usa para controlar el acceso y registrar revisiones.  

 

Seguridad

La seguridad del usuario se usa para limitar el acceso a la actualización de elementos del modelo. Este provee control sobre quien en un proyecto puede hacer cambios a elementos del modelo. 

 

Para más información acerca de el uso de EA con modelos compartidos y despliegue de equipo por favor ver el despliegue del papel en blanco de Enterprise Architect disponible en 

www.sparxsystems.com.au/downloads/whitepapers/EA_Deployment.pdf.

 

Tenga en cuenta: El soporte del repositorio DBMS y la Seguridad del Usuario no están disponibles con la Edición Corporativa de Enterprise Architect.

 

Vea también

Desarrollo distribuido
Compartir proyecto
Importar/Exportar XMI
Replicación
Control de paquete
Control de versiones
Seguridad de usuario